KUALA LUMPUR, Jan 26 — Despite its explanation, the Education Ministry continued to come under fire from some parents of the SMK Infant Jesus Convent in Johor over a workshop for students who will be sitting for their Sijil Pelajaran Malaysia .

“Both Phase One and Phase Two of these workshops were never discussed at PTA meetings, nor was approval sought for the use of funds for them,” the parents were quoted as saying in their joint statement. “Through the explanation given by the school and in line with the statement issued by the Ministry of Education, the programme that was run by the school did not ignore or discriminate against the religion and ethnicity of students.
